In this CPU comparison, we compare the Intel Xeon Platinum 8276 and the A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X and use benchmarks to check which processor is faster.

We compare the Intel Xeon Platinum 8276 28 core processor released in Q2/2019 with the A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X which has 8 CPU cores and was introduced in Q3/2017.

CPU Cores and Base Frequency

The Intel Xeon Platinum 8276 is a 28 core processor with a clock frequency of 2.20 GHz (4.00 GHz). The processor can compute 56 threads at the same time. The A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X clocks with 3.80 GHz (4.00 GHz), has 8 CPU cores and can calculate 16 threads in parallel.

Memory & PCIe

Up to 1024 GB of memory in a maximum of 6 memory channels is supported by the Intel Xeon Platinum 8276, while the A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X supports a maximum of GB of memory with a maximum memory bandwidth of 85.4 GB/s enabled.

Thermal Management

The Intel Xeon Platinum 8276 has a TDP of 165 W. The TDP of the A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X is 180 W. System integrators use the TDP of the processor as a guide when dimensioning the cooling solution.

Technical details

The Intel Xeon Platinum 8276 has 38.50 MB cache and is manufactured in 14 nm. The cache of AMD Ryzen Threadripper 1900X is at 20.00 MB. The processor is manufactured in 14 nm.
